What's the sum of all the integers between √3 and √89 ?

So the closest integer above the square root of 3 is 2, and the closest integer below the square root of 89 is 9. (square root of 4 and 81, respectively.)

So we just want to add together all numbers between (including) 2 and 9.

So,

2 + 3 + 4 + 5 + 6 + 7 + 8 + 9

Or,

11 * 4

44
